Arthur Cox was very pleased to have advised Wells Fargo on the provision of an upsized revolving credit facility of €300 million to IPUT Real Estate Dublin. The facility includes a €200 million green finance component in line with the Loan Market Association (LMA)’s green loans principles.

Arthur Cox has been involved in a number of financings which include a green loan or sustainable loan component, including advising Greencore Group plc on Ireland’s first sustainability linked revolving credit facility, and also advised on Ireland’s first sovereign green bond.
